Hand paint with acrylic and wipe off the rest with a damp rag. The entire surface had several layers of Shellac before I painted.
60 degree Whiteside V-Bit. The font is Edwardian Script with Bold setting on. The Block Letter was originally Goudy.
The most difficult part was issues with the Vectors. Both those fonts have tons of errors and overlaps. You must "Convert to Curves" all the fonts and then fix the errors, adjust the spacing manually (for Edwardian Script) and then Weld the characters together. Then "Check Vectors" 10 million times and fix the errors.
I've a template file I'll upload that has the entire Goudy Alphabet already converted and Fixed with each letter on its own layer. The template still needs some finishing touches.
I wish a Gadget allowed me to replace the contents of a Text Box. That would allow me to build a gadget to automate some of the process.
